Meet our Core Team

Sheikh Muhammed Moeen

Managing Director

With over two decades of experience in leadership roles of regulated business, Moeen is a seasoned finance expert in banking, real estate, corporate finance & asset management businesses. He has served as CFO of listed commercial banks, regulated REITs and has successfully led sharia complaint businesses across diverse markets in Middle East , Eastern Africa & Asia.

His diversified experience profile include fund/debt raising, IPOs & listing, M&As, sell-offs & business set-ups, besides core financial reporting & governance expertise in multiple regulated jurisdictions. A member of ICAEW & ICAP, Moeen remained engaged with PricewaterhouseCoopers and carries a proven track record of navigating through most challenging operating environments.

Naima Kazmi

Investment & Finance Partner

Naima brings with her nearly two decades of private equity & venture capital experience including investment evaluation, post-acquisition portfolio management, business development, and fund-raising in the MENA & South Asia regions being based in Riyadh & Dubai. More recently, she worked on a pre & post-acquisition transition for a leading regional e-commerce company in the UAE and played in a key role in positioning the company for an eventual IPO.

Naima has held senior management roles in private equity funds, portfolio companies & corporates. She has a Bachelor of Arts degree in Economics & English Literature from Rutgers University, USA

Ammar Azhar

Director

Ammar Azhar is an approved Finance Officer for DFSA. He carries over 15 years of experience in finance, corporate strategy, compliance & business growth in private equity, technology, food & beverage and large conglomerates.

Previously with KPMG, a leading private equity group and now in financial services & consulting business, he has specialized in financial governance, strategy and forensic investigations. He has successfully established finance outsourcing model serving a wide array of global clientele with unmatched services. A graduate of Oxford University, UK, Ammar is a member of ICAEW & ACCA.

Gayatri Prabhu

Financial Consultant

Gayatri is a qualified Chartered accountant with an experience profile of over a decade in accounting and financial services in UAE and India. She has remained involved with some large UAE family groups specializing in real estate, construction and trading businesses operating via multiple corporate structures. 

Prior to this, she has reminded an auditor and compliance specialist in top audit firms both in India and UAE, where she was engaged in finance, accounting and auditing services. She is a commerce graduate and speaks multiple languages.

Meet our Advisory Board Members

Akhtar M. Zaidi

Advisory Board Member

A distinguished financial expert, Akhtar M Zaidi is a former partner at Coopers & Lybrand (now PwC) with a rich career spanning London, Lagos & New York. His notable achievements include co-foundingDabbagh Information Technology with Softbank, leading the privatization and $720 million acquisition of K-Electric, and establishing Pakistan’s first $680 million consortium of private sector lender club of ADB & IFC and local DFIs.
In his leadership roles in various positions and as advisor to top corporates in Europe, Middle East & Asia, Akhtar has closed M&A deals exceeding $3.5 billion globally. Mr. Zaidi holds fellowships from ICAEW & ICAP, reflecting his global leadership in financial transformation and corporate strategy

Robert Richards

Advisory Board Member

Robert Richards is a veteran business strategist and executive coach with over 50 years of experience advising leaders, boards, and organizations across the Middle East, UK, and Europe. His expertise spans leadership development, strategic alignment, performance optimization, and executive resourcing—delivering results across sectors including FMCG, hospitality, insurance, construction, banking, and financial services.

Based in Dubai, Robert has held senior leadership roles in top consulting firms, most notably serving as a Senior Partner and board member at Crowe UAE, where he played an integral role in high-level client engagements and strategic advisory work.

A former Royal Marines Commando and graduate of the T.S. Arethusa maritime programme, Robert is an ICF-accredited coach, a Marshall Goldsmith Executive Coach, and holds certifications in cognitive behavior and NLP. He is also a recipient of the prestigious Freedom of the City of London, recognizing his contributions to the investment sector.

Florence Le Fur

Advisory Board Member

Ms Florence Le Fur is a highly accomplished real estate investment executive with over twenty years of experience in the European & MENA region. Florence’s experience spans investment management, valuation and deal structuring in sectors like commercial, residential & retail real estate. She has led the strategic direction of numerous investments & played a pivotal role in coordinating multifaceted business initiatives, leveraging her extensive expertise to drive growth and innovation within the organizations she has served.

Ms Le Fur holds a MBA from INSEAD, France, honors from ESSEC Business School & University of Paris
I – Panthéon La Sorbonne.

Arsheen Saulat

Advisory Board Member

A specialist in corporate structuring, compliance , governance and regulatory framework, Arsheen Saulat carries an illustrious career and experience profile spanning over 2 decades covering Middle East, Asian and European financial services industry She has successfully headed the legal & compliance function of listed and regulated businesses as well as discharged responsibilities in senior role at the Dubai Financial Services Authority (DFSA).

Arsheen has impeccable grip on DFSA / FSRA rules, listing regulations , risk management, corporate governance, surveillance and exchanges rules and has played key role in listing debt instruments in global markets. A graduate from King’s College London, she has extensive experience in setting up and managing regulatory structures for financial entities across the MENA region.

Daniel W. Gay

Advisory Board Member

Daniel Gay is a financial professional with over 22 years of experience in Private Banking & Wealth Management, specializing in GCC markets, including Saudi Arabia & UAE. He began his career at Credit Suisse in Geneva, progressing through various roles for 12 years, and then joined Credit Agricole Indosuez. Daniel relocated to Abu Dhabi in 2004 as head UBS AG’s Representative Office for five years.
Daniel held senior roles at Citibank, Bank of Singapore, & a Dubai-based Multi-Family Office and worked as the Business Development Director for the largest Sharia-compliant REIT, where he led strategic partnerships and investor growth for six years.

Fluent in French & English, Daniel works closely with UHNWIs and institutions, providing bespoke advisory services.
